Organizers said Thicke's hip-swivelling song and the album of the same name both qualify for Junos, though he would receive any such honour for the tune alone -- American collaborators Pharrell Williams and T.I. would receive credit only as featured non-Canadian artists, the Canadian Academy of Recording Arts and Sciences said.
